linux上的logo通常位于/etc/initramfs-tools/templates/default/theme.cfg文件中。要清除logo,请执行以下步骤:
编辑theme.cfg文件
使用文本编辑器(如nano或vi)打开/etc/initramfs-tools/templates/default/theme.cfg文件:
bash
sudo nano /etc/initramfs-tools/templates/default/theme.cfg
删除logo行
找到以下行并将其删除或注释掉(使用 ):
cfg
LOGO=/usr/share/initramfs-tools/themes/ubuntu/logo.png
保存并退出
保存文件并退出文本编辑器。
更新initramfs
运行以下命令更新initramfs映像:
bash
sudo update-initramfs -u
重启
重启系统以应用更改。
其他
除了修改theme.cfg文件外,还可以通过以下 清除logo:
使用Plymouth主题
Plymouth是一个启动时显示的引导画面管理器。它提供了一个主题系统,允许您自定义启动画面。您可以安装并启用没有logo的Plymouth主题,例如plymouth-theme-text-only。
禁用initramfs
initramfs是一个临时文件系统,在系统启动时加载。您可以禁用initramfs,这样就不会显示logo。但是,这样做可能会影响某些系统的启动过程。
删除logo文件
您可以删除位于/usr/share/initramfs-tools/themes/